Aerospace and defense applications demand temperature measurements with near-microscopic precision—think jet engine sensors or missile guidance systems. Temperature dry well calibrators rise to the challenge with:
Ultra-Tight Stability: Models with ±0.005°C stability for calibrating sensors in hypersonic wind tunnels.
Material Compatibility: Inert metal wells (e.g., Inconel) that resist corrosion from aerospace fluids.
Traceability: Calibrations linked to national standards (e.g., NIST, UKAS) to meet military specs like MIL-STD-883. This article explores how dry wells ensure reliability in extreme conditions, from sub-zero altitudes to desert test ranges.
